Furness BS

Based in Barrow-in-Furness, Cumbria, the Furness Building Society is both independent and mutual. Unlike banks and converted building societies, they have no shareholders that they need to pay dividends to. This means they can pass on more of the profit they earn into their services and rates.

Halifax

Halifax merged with the Bank of Scotland in September 2001 to form the Edinburgh-based HBOS (Halifax Bank of Scotland) Group. After the move, HBOS had 22 million customers, assets of over £400 billion and ‘a relationship with two out of every five households in the UK’.

HFC Bank

HFC Bank provides products and services through a range of brands including Hamilton Direct and Marbles. HFC Bank currently has 3 million customers throughout the UK, making it one of the UK’s largest consumer finance businesses. In March 2003 HFC Bank became part of the HSBC Bank Group.
